무거운 설치 또는 데스크탑 앱이 필요하지 않은 PHP 콘솔?

StackOverflow https://stackoverflow.com/questions/604635

  •  03-07-2019
  •  | 
  •  

문제

무슨 일이 일어나고 있는지보고 싶을 때 PHP에서 인쇄 명령을 사용하는 현재 습관을 깨는 깨끗한 방법을 찾고 있습니다.

Zend Debugger와 같은 옵션을 알고 있지만 사용합니다. 코다 개발을 위해서는 다른 소프트웨어를 혼합하거나 서버 명령을 수행해야합니다. 코드베이스에 추가 할 수있는 콘솔이 필요합니다.

이와 같은 것이 존재합니까? 또한 무엇을 사용하고 그 이유는 무엇입니까?

편집하다: 거기에 많은 것들이 있었지만 더 간단한 것이 필요했기 때문에 직접 코딩했습니다. 오래 걸리지 않았지만 (매우 예쁘지는 않지만) 내 서버 관심있는 다른 사람을 위해.

도움이 되었습니까?

해결책

당신이 사용할 수있는 xdebug 어떤 것과 함께 디버깅 정보를 볼 수있는 많은 옵션.

다른 팁

Google Chrome의 확장이 매우 좋습니다. PHP 콘솔.

거기 있습니다 Firephp PHP 로그 메시지를 Firebug 콘솔에 작성합니다.

Zend Debugger와 같은 옵션을 알고 있지만 개발에 Coda를 사용하고 다른 소프트웨어를 혼합하거나 서버 명령을 수행 해야하는 데 관심이 없습니다. 코드베이스에 추가 할 수있는 콘솔이 필요합니다.

내가 당신을 이해하는지 완전히 확신하지 못하지만 당신은 할 수 없었습니다. 파일에 로그인하십시오 그런 다음 콘솔 창을 실행하십시오 tail -f /path/to/log-file.txt? 그것은 나에게 꽤 잘 작동합니다. 물론, 당신 하다 이를 위해 서버에 대한 콘솔 연결이 필요합니다.

코다 사용? 그것은 당신이 Mac을 사용하고 있음을 의미합니다. 당신은 아마 Xdebug를보고 싶을 것입니다 http://www.bluestatic.org/software/macgdbp/

Chromephp라는 Chrome을위한 또 다른 확장 기능이 있습니다. 다른 솔루션보다 조금 간단합니다.
https://chrome.google.com/webstore/detail/noaneddfkdjfnfdakjjmocngkffehhd

시작 안내서가 안내서 :
http://www.chromephp.com

During my development career i have not stumbled upon a software that displays the output you describe in your question. It would be a wonderful program or feature i believe but sadly i have not found any.

Like Andrew and nickf have answered, there are some good tools out there and until someone sits down and writes this, it looks like we are out in the cold.

I was looking for similar solution which wasn't heavy and even better I didn't need to include any classes, so I created simple function that outputs php to browser console, you can check it here:

enter image description here

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top